When bridges change, only close the circuits for the bridges we stopped using
In #3200 (moved) we changed things so we drop all prebuilt circuits every time a bridge changes. We don't actually have to go that far -- we could just drop the ones that used bridges that aren't configured anymore.
We could also do that for entrynodes, exitnodes, etc etc if you wanted to get fancy.
To upload designs, you'll need to enable LFS and have an admin enable hashed storage. More information